Default Need help for left turn signal/running lights problems

Ok, so I took my 06 Nighttrain to a shop because left blinkers weren't working at all and my front and rear running lights were out as well. They are aftermarket blinkers(not sure what kind) and I have LED bulbs in the rear. The shop fixed it quickly and they worked fine for a day. Now I'm having the same issue again. This is my first bike and I'm no mechanic, especially when it comes to electrical and have no clue what I'm looking for! I just don't wanna spend anymore money than needed if its something I can do myself with some experienced guidance.

I'm assuming its probably a short somewhere, but, haven't had anytime to look anywhere other than under the seat. Do I need to pull the tank and look at the wires and look under the rear fender for bare wires? Any input would be greatly appreciated!!!

Default Problem solved!!

Ok, so its been a few months since i got on here, but, the problem has been fixed. I removed the rear fender and found that my back tire had rubbed the wires to my blinker bare and they were grounding out! Unfortunately, the rubbed so close to the blinker housing that they were unrepairable...in short, I bought new ones and replaced/wired in a new set. It will eventually happen again due to the placement of the lights on the fender(custom cut on stock fender) I guess the only fix for that is to relocate turn signals to the frame somewhere.
